Fake Gems Found In Czech National Museum The famous gem collection in Prague recently faced some controversy, when several of the diamonds and precious stones, presumably all assumed to be worth millions of dollars, turned out to be fakes. This news was uncovered during a routine audit of the museum. The precious stones that turned out to be fake included a 5 carat diamond, which was discovered to be simply glass, a 19 carat sapphire, which turned out to be synthetic, and at least half of the rubies, according to www.thediamondloupe.com. HKTDC - Hong Kong International Diamond, Gem & Pearl Show The Hong Kong International Diamond, Gem & Pearl Show was held at the AsiaWorld Expo, at the Hong Kong International Airport, February 27th - March 3rd. The show was a massive success, and was organized by the Hong Kong Trade Development Council. The show featured over 4,500 exhibitors, and over 87,000 buyers. The International Diamond Week Occurring February 5th through the 7th of 2018, the famed International Diamond Week, held by the Israel Diamond Exchange, took place. The 7th annual interactive diamond show included a rich and high-quality selection of diamonds for sale, as well as polished and rough diamond tenders. As stated by IDWI Chairman Ezra Bloom, “The International Diamond Week is a wonderful opportunity to spotlight the amazing jewelry collections being created by our bourse members”. Shapes of Diamonds When it comes to diamonds, there are several aspects that determine how brilliant it is and how much it shines. One of these determining aspects is the shape of the diamond itself. Diamonds are commonly cut in 9 different shapes, which include: Round, Princess, Cushion, Marquise, Emerald, Radiant, Pear, Oval, and Asscher. Round Out of the 9 different shapes, round is the most popular. A round brilliant shape is cut in a way that shows off it’s brilliance and beauty best. What Is A DTC Sightholder? Directly associated with the diamond powerhouse, De Beers Company, DTC Sightholders are essentially the direct clients of De Beers. DTC Sightholders must go through a strict initiation process, comply with De Beers BPPs, and achieve a satisfactory score on the required CPQ test in order to qualify. In DTC Sightholder, the first three letters, DTC, stand for diamond trading company, which is the distribution and sales division of the De Beers Company. De Beers Group Established in the year 1888 by Cecil Rhodes, a British businessman, De Beers Group is the leading diamond company in the world. With many specializations, including diamond mining, diamond exploration, diamond retail, diamond trading, and diamond manufacturing, De Beers Group operates in 35 different countries around the world, and mines out of Canada, South Africa, Botswana, and Namibia. Currently, the diamond company has a 35% stake in the entire world’s diamond production, and only recently have they experienced any type of competition.
